Which is cheaper, Red Rocks Community College or Aveda Institute-Denver?
Red Rocks Community College, at $9,044 a year after aid versus $20,167 — a gap of $11,123 a year, or $44,492 across the full degree. These are net prices after grants and scholarships, not sticker prices, so they reflect what an aided student pays.
Do Red Rocks Community College or Aveda Institute-Denver graduates earn more?
Red Rocks Community College graduates report a median $46,288 ten years after entry, $8,268 more than the $38,020 at Aveda Institute-Denver. Both are institution-wide medians from federal tax records, so a high-paying major at the lower school can beat the average at the higher one.
Which leaves students with less debt, Red Rocks Community College or Aveda Institute-Denver?
Red Rocks Community College: its completers carry a median $9,500 in federal loans versus $9,829 at Aveda Institute-Denver, a difference of $329. The figure counts students who finished; it excludes private loans and anyone who left before graduating.
Which graduates more of its students?
84% of students finish at Aveda Institute-Denver, against 32% at Red Rocks Community College. Completion matters to the ROI arithmetic because a degree that is never finished still carries its cost and its debt, but earns none of the graduate premium above the $48,360 high-school baseline.
